Definitions:

Compound Interest

This is when interest is earned on the principal amount as well as on the interest that has accumulated in earlier periods.

Earnings Rate

The rate at which a company or an investment grows its profit over a specific period, usually expressed as a percentage.

Net Present Value

Net Present Value (NPV) is a financial metric that calculates the value of a series of cash flows over time, discounted back to their present value to assess an investment's profitability.

Desired Rate of Return

The minimum return a company or investor expects to achieve on an investment, often used in capital budgeting to evaluate potential projects.
